Pt100 RTD Sensor

Element Type:SMD Thin Film Platinum Resistance Thermistor
Element Dimensions:3.2mm x 1.6mm x 0.7mm
Temperature Coefficient (TCR):3850 ppm/°C
Temperature Measurement Range:-50°C to +200°C
Long-Term Stability:≤±0.06% resistance drift of R₀°C after 1000 hours at 200°C
Terminal Type:Tin alloy terminals
Soldering Method:Reflow soldering or wave soldering. High-temperature solder paste recommended.
Soldering temperature: 230-240°C

Pt100 RTD Sensor Specifications

Parameter Value
Element Type SMD Thin Film Platinum Resistor
Dimensions 3.2mm x 1.6mm x 0.7mm
Temperature Range -50°C to +200°C
TCR (Temperature Coefficient) 3850 ppm/°C
Long-Term Stability ≤±0.06% drift after 1000h at 200°C
Terminal Type Tin alloy (reflow/wave soldering)
Soldering Temperature 230–240°C (high-temp paste recommended)
